Click on Federal Taxes, then select Deductions & Credits, then I'll Choose What I Work On, then scroll down to the section entitled You and Your Family. The first choice in that list of items is Child and Dependent Care Credit. That's where you'll enter your childcare expense information.
I AM TRYING TO INPUT THE CHILD CARE/BABYSITTING EXPENSES I HAVE EVEN THOUGH I AM NOT THE CUSTODIAL PARENT OR CLAIM HIM THIS YEAR BUT THE SECTION WILL NOT OPEN AND LET ME DO IT
Childcare expenses only go on the return of the person claiming the child. A noncustodial parent is not eligible.
